Transaction 0605efd14bc33912f003203989eb0d73fd5ed62223ac67e2529fab7d3bb98f36
1 Input
1 Output
-
0605efd14bc33912f003203989eb0d73fd5ed62223ac67e2529fab7d3bb98f36:0
- value
- 1562920000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 979ea77617a6f7a86a5c39bdb02c5b8f85be07aa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Eph6T5m7jJpmxTSREhLjMG12FXVBbn3oq